Parasite Mining Pool Strikes Gold Again with Second Bitcoin Block

A revolutionary Bitcoin mining pool, Parasite Pool, has achieved a significant milestone by mining its second block, marking a crucial step in proving the effectiveness of its innovative hybrid model. This model differs from traditional pay-per-share and pure lottery approaches by awarding 1 BTC to the block finder and distributing the remaining 2.125 BTC, along with fees, proportionally among all pool participants based on their shares submitted. The pool's design eliminates participation fees and utilizes the Lightning Network for payouts. The mining process involves computers competing to solve complex cryptographic puzzles every 10 minutes, with the winner earning the right to add the next block of transactions to the blockchain and collecting a reward. Currently, this reward is 3.125 BTC plus transaction fees, valued at approximately $238,000. The mining landscape is dominated by large-scale industrial operators, but Parasite Pool targets home miners. Founded by ZK Shark, the creator of the Ordinal Maxi Biz NFT collection on Bitcoin, Parasite Pool's approach aims to balance the lottery aspect of mining with a more consistent distribution of rewards. Unlike pure solo pools, Parasite Pool's hybrid model preserves the excitement of a potential large payday while ensuring that participants receive satoshis during the intervals between blocks. The successful mining of the second block, which included 7,398 transactions and 0.002 BTC in fees, occurred approximately 48 days after the first block and demonstrates the pool's ability to retain hashrate and validate its proportional distribution mechanics. With a current hashrate of 52 petahashes per second, Parasite Pool accounts for roughly 0.005% of Bitcoin's estimated 1-zetahash network hashrate. As the pattern of solo and small-pool mining continues to gain attention, Parasite Pool's hybrid model is being closely watched to see if it can sustain participant engagement through the inevitable losing stretches. A third block mined within the next two months would significantly validate the pool's approach, while a prolonged drought would raise questions about the long-term viability of this model.
